Overview

Responsible for leading and executing large, complex EPC estimates. This position oversees the estimating process from receipt of bid documents through final estimate review and proposal submission, ensuring that all estimates are accurate, comprehensive, competitive, and aligned with organizational objectives. Serving as the Lead Estimator on assigned pursuits, the Estimating Manager establishes estimating strategies, defines project scope, evaluates assumptions, identifies risks and opportunities, and ensures the successful delivery of high-quality estimate packages.

The Estimating Manager coordinates and manages estimating resources across multiple pursuits, directing the work of the estimating team members to ensure estimates are completed accurately and within required timelines. This role is responsible for ensuring compliance with client requirements, internal estimating standards, review processes, and established best practices. The position collaborates closely with project management, operations, engineering, procurement, and executive leadership to develop estimate strategies, support bid reviews, and facilitate seamless turnover from project execution teams.
